Morello is renowned for his innovative guitar techniques and radical lyrics. He co-founded the rap metal band Rage Against the Machine in 1991. The band became famous for its anti-establishment messages.
Their self-titled debut album was a critical and commercial success. It sold over three million copies in the United States alone. Songs like ‘Killing in the Name’ became anthems.
Beyond music, Morello is a Harvard graduate in political science. He has been a vocal advocate for numerous social justice causes. His activism is deeply integrated into his artistic output.
He has also performed with other notable acts like Audioslave and Prophets of Rage. Morello’s distinctive sound involves heavy use of effects pedals. He often creates sounds resembling turntable scratches.
